- The distance between Porto Velho, Brazil and Pecora, Russia is approximately 12,304 km or 7,646 mi.
- To reach Porto Velho in this distance one would set out from Pecora bearing 295.2°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Porto Velho bearing 202.6° or SSW .
- Porto Velho has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Pecora has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Porto Velho is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Pecora is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 27.6 °C (49.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 34.1 °C (61.4°F) less in Porto Velho.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1775.2 mm (69.9 in) more which is equivalent to 1775.2 l/m² (43.57 US gal/ft²) or 17,752,000 l/ha (1,897,807 US gal/ac) more. About 4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 48.2° higher in Porto Velho than in Pecora.
